Key benefits of membership include:

Representation
  • Influence and industry leadership - industry representation to government and others, including upwards through construction umbrella bodies.
  • Representation and input - participation on BS and European committees and other regulatory bodies in an advisory capacity and influencing role to determine material and installations standards.
  • Involvement with other organisations - representation to Construction Products Association,  National Specialist Contractors Council and ConstructionSkills and close working links and joint events with other industry organisations.

Promotion of members

  • AIS website - registering some 12,000 visits a month, the AIS website contains a directory search facility, with a free link to members' own websites.
  • Advertising and editorial opportunities - 
    • Interiors Focus - a bi-annual full colour magazine promoting members products, services, contracts, literature and industry news to over 25,000 building industry professionals. Interiors Focus is distributed with Building magazine.
    • Interiors Insight - a full colour A3 newsletter published 3/4 times a year, which provides members with a forum to communicate with each other and allows the AIS to keep members abreast of AIS and industry issues.
  • AIS brand awareness - including profile leaflet and construction press marketing campaigns to raise the profile of AIS amongst specifiers, encouraging them to select AIS member companies.
Provision of information

  • Annual conference and national members meetings - held in the UK and abroad with topical speakers and networking opportunities.
  • Advisory Service - for problem installations.
  • Member Zone - a password protected exclusive members only area on the AIS website packed full of useful information.
  • AIS Factfile - regularly updated with information of relevance to the interiors fit-out sector.
  • E-Bulletin - regularly e-mailed bulletins containing topical information, sent to as many company contacts as required.
  • Site Guides - Good straightforward best practice guides for Suspended Ceilings, Raised Access Flooring, Drylining, Partitioning and Wallcoverings.

Other services 
  • Helplines - free advice on Technical, Contractual and Legal, Training, Health and Safety, Employment Affairs and Taxation.
  • Credit checking - a free credit checking service for members.
  • Insurance - discounted business insurance scheme tailored to AIS members.
  • AIS Health & Safety Handbook - an easy to understand health & safety handbook aimed in particular at site-based operatives.
  • Training - management courses provided through NISTG and general training advice.
  • Yellow Pages - discounted Advertising opportunities.
  • Contractors awards - A prestigous award scheme held annually to promote high levels of workmanship, which receive extensive publicity.
